A manometer reads the pressure of a gas in a enclosure as shown in figure(a) When some of the gas is removed by a pump, the manometer reads as in (b). The liquid used in the manometers is mercury and the atmospheric pressure is `76 cm` of mercury.

(i) Give the absolute and gauge pressure of the gas in the enclosure for cases (a) and (b) in units of cm of mercury .
(ii) How would the level change in case (b) if `13.6 cm` of water are poured into the right limb of the manometer?

(i) Absolute pressure in part (a)
`=76cm` of `Hg+20cm` of `Hg`
`=96cm` of `Hg`
Gauge pressure in part (a) `=20cm` of `Hg`
Absolute pressure in part (b)
`=76cm` of `Hg-18cm` of `Hg=58 cm` of `Hg`
Gauge pressure in part (b) `=-18 cm of Hg`
(ii) `13.6 cm` of water is equivalent to `1 cm` of `Hg`. so the new level difference will become `19 cm`.
